BBL Picks Up Public Relations Duties for Fairchild

BBL Advertising has won the public relations account of Fairchild Semiconductor after a review.





As a result, the small shop in Acton, Mass., specializing in technology accounts, plans to open a second office in Silicon Valley, according to agency president Barbara Sabran. Even though the electronics supplier is headquartered in South Portland, Maine, a couple of its larger divisions are in Santa Clara, Calif., necessitating the additional office.





Fairchild was relaunched in January when certain product lines were bought from National Semiconductor by a private group of investors.





BBL is also looking to add a public relations executive with investor relations experience to augment the Fairchild team headed up by public relations director Paul Hughes.
